I think there are accents. I just got finished rereading the harper hall trilogy and at one point in... I think it was Dragondrums, Piemur is in Nabol Hold as a spy, dressed as a herder's boy, and he uses an accent, which he also used earlier in the book at a mine when the Oldtimers visited, so as not to get caught.

More than likely there are accents on Pern, though perhaps not such noteable differences between them in most cases that they bear mentioning. *shrug*

Yes, Pern does have accents. Read the Harper Hall Trilogy, as well as The Skies of Pern, and both books mention using one's accent to determine where the person is from. It's just like on Earth. Here in America, we can usually determine what state a person is from just from the way they talk. Further, people in a single state can usually determine what area of the state, again just from the way the other person talks. Different areas start to develop their own way of talking after even so little a period of time as 10 years. Amazing thing, the human voice XD

And here I'm agreeing with Teki. Make-up is archaic on Pern (think of medieval-type make-up). As such, it's not going to be used on an everyday basis. Jaxom used a type of creamy foundation to cover up the Threadscore on his cheek for a while. Luckily it blended in enough with his natural skin color that no one really noticed it.
